Every so often (every few minutes or so?) a fraction of a second of sound will
repeat itself from a few seconds before. This seems to happen in every
application; I can't point out any single steps that cause or prevent it.

I am running PulseAudio 10.0 (from repository), on Manjaro 4.9.27-1.

I've attached a verbose log below. I first noticed a repeat at the 758 second
mark. The output there suggests that this bug is caused by an underrun, and
perhaps the rewind that subsequently occurs is too far?
